OpenAI and Broadcom Partnership Overview
OpenAI has entered into a significant partnership with Broadcom, involving a deal worth over $1 billion aimed at enhancing AI computing capabilities. This collaboration is part of OpenAI’s broader strategy to scale its AI models and improve performance across various applications.
Key Details of the Partnership
Financial Commitment
The deal is valued at more than $1 billion, marking a substantial investment in AI infrastructure. This investment is expected to facilitate the development of advanced chips specifically designed for AI workloads.
Chip Development
Broadcom will be responsible for creating specialized chips that will support OpenAI’s computational needs. These chips are anticipated to enhance the efficiency and speed of AI model training and inference, which is crucial for OpenAI’s operations.
Strategic Importance
This partnership is seen as a strategic move for both companies. For OpenAI, it provides access to cutting-edge technology that can improve its AI offerings. For Broadcom, it positions the company as a key player in the rapidly growing AI market.
Market Context
The collaboration comes at a time when demand for AI technologies is surging, with companies across various sectors looking to integrate AI into their operations. This deal is expected to bolster OpenAI’s competitive edge in the AI landscape.
Future Implications
The partnership is likely to lead to advancements in AI capabilities, potentially resulting in new products and services that leverage the enhanced computational power provided by Broadcom’s chips.
